Gwaith
gwaith is a Sindarin word meaning "'people' associated by place and occupation". The forms -weith and waith are often used of "regions in proper names or peoples".
Examples
- denoting people
- — Danwaith
- — Forodwaith = "People of the North"
- — Gaurwaith
- — Gwaith-i-Mírdain = "Brotherhood of Jewel-smiths"
- — Tawarwaith
- denoting region or land
- — Drúwaith Iaur
- — Enedwaith
- — Forodwaith
- — Haradwaith
